About usCarnall Farrar (CF) is a growing consultancy which works across all aspects of the health sector from supporting the NHS to serving major life science companies. We are passionate about, and experts in, health and healthcare. Founded in 2013 we have grown to a core staff base of management consultants, technical consultants, a data operations team and corporate functions. We have a strong reputation with the NHS, and our actively seeking to spread awareness of our brand and offers across the health sector more broadly. We are highly regarded both internally and externally for the level of support and development we give our people. As a professional services business, CF has three primary assets – its people, its knowledge and its data and associated products.Our strategic intent  We are focused on building the leading consulting company dedicated to the health sector. We serve the entire sector including healthcare systems (providers, payors, regulators), life sciences (pharma, biotech, devices, and diagnostics), health investing, health tech (data, digital and apps) and the wider suppliers to the sector (infrastructure, consumables and supporting services). Our clients include public sector organisations, private sector companies and investors.   We help organisations to improve population health and the effectiveness of life sciences and healthcare through understanding their aspirations, helping them to identify the opportunities to create value, spotting and applying innovation in practice, adopting best-in-class management approaches and providing hands-on support to deliver improvements.   Our consulting is renowned for its use of data and the insights this creates. We have access to more UK healthcare data than any other company and are expert it its safe use for delivering healthcare, improving health, managing services, supporting uptake of innovation, undertaking research, and generating evidence. Our access to data and our engineering and data science capabilities supports our consulting, and they are also available for direct client services including in multidisciplinary teams.   We are growing a team of expert consultants who want to be at the leading edge of the profession and who have a passion for health. With structured career development from Analyst to Partner in a model of apprenticeship, mentorship, and formal training alongside opportunities to work in industry we are cultivating the leaders of the future. Continuously develop your own skills, seek feedback, and share knowledge to stay ahead of industry trends and best practices Flexible workingWe follow a hybrid working model that balances in person connections and remote work to drive exceptional client impact. We enjoy working in person together with clients and colleagues and work where clients need us to be.In supporting flexibility and remote working, team members can work from home one day per week as standard. Additionally, we offer 44 remote working days per year which can be used to top up your working from home days and enable you to work from home up to two days per week-subject to client needs. Alternatively, you could use your allowance in blocks to manage school holidays or other commitments. Our core in person working hours are from 10am until 4pm allowing you that extra flexibility to manage your schedule in a way that works for you.
